William Lee Ellis comes with his powerful passionate acoustic blues full of chromatic beauty This singer and guitar player has gained a big recognition among specialized media from London to Los Angeles William’s musical language follows the same direction the sun runs, that is to say from Delta to Appalachian mountains This is the most complete album Ellis has recorded till now, because he has included a capella gospel music, highland music, some country but, over all, new musical structures all gathered from old traditional musical stereotypes Ellis takes back with his own personal style William performs his own compositions but he also does tastefully Chuck Berry’s covers or beautiful Mississippi John Hurt’s or Yank Rachell’s blues songs In short words, this is a very gratifying piece of work
